Primary Purpose
The VMO Ophthalmologist will provide senior clinical leadership and specialist ophthalmic services within the Department of Ophthalmology at Wagga Wagga Base Hospital. The role includes:

* Delivering specialist ophthalmic assessment, diagnosis, treatment, and ongoing care.
* Contributing to safe, effective, evidence-based clinical practice aligned with MLHD values.
* Providing expert advice on service delivery, planning, and medical governance.
* Supporting clinical governance to ensure safe, high-quality services across MLHD.
* Participation in the on‑call roster. Required to participate in a 1‑in‑4 on‑call rotation, including weekend coverage.
* Clinical teaching and supervision. Expected involvement in registrar teaching and supervision in clinics (average of two clinics per week) and active participation in operating theatre sessions.
* Equitable contribution. All ophthalmologists are expected to undertake a proportionate and equitable share of public hospital operating lists, registrar clinics, and associated supervision responsibilities.

Key Accountabilities
Clinical Responsibilities

* Provide high quality ophthalmic services, including diagnostic and therapeutic procedures.
* Supervise junior medical staff to ensure safe practice and accurate documentation.
* Monitor clinical indicators and outcomes, benchmarking against best practice.

Training, Mentoring & Supervision

* Supervise and support JMOs, Fellows, and trainees in line with accreditation requirements.
* Contribute to registrar training and assist in maintaining RANZCO accreditation.
* Participate in education programs for trainees.
* Contribute to clinical meetings, teaching activities, and Grand Rounds.

Clinical Quality, Safety & Audit

* Participate in quality improvement, risk management, M&M meetings, and audit activities.
* Monitor service delivery to ensure compliance with role delineation and regulatory standards.

Following orientation, VMOs are expected to supervise other doctors and medical students (excluding conditionally registered overseas trained doctors).

Selection Criteria

* Registration with the Medical Board of Australia as a Specialist Ophthalmologist, with Fellowship of the Royal Australian and New Zealand College of Ophthalmologists (RANZCO).
* Demonstrated technical and professional competence as a Consultant Ophthalmologist, with recent clinical hospital experience (within the last two years).
* Demonstrated participation in, and commitment to, Ophthalmology specific quality assurance activities.
* Demonstrated experience in clinical roles within a multidisciplinary healthcare environment.
* Proven ability to work effectively and harmoniously within multidisciplinary teams.
* Demonstrated commitment to the NSW Health CORE values and MLHD values, goals, and strategic priorities.
